Our expert tip
Adjust the pupil distance properly for an optimal round field of view. For the 10×50 version, the minimum distance is 63 mm. This will prevent distortion at the edges and allow you to see a full image.

Specifications
Capacity
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Design | Roof |
| Enlargement | 10× |
| Front lens diameter (mm) | 50 |
| Exit pupil (mm) | 5,14 |
| Eye relief (mm) | 18,1 |
| Eyepiece caps | Rotatable |
| Diopter compensation | -3 |
| Interpupillar distance (mm) | 60-79 |
| Glass material | BaK-4 |
| Lens coating | complete, multiple |
Focus system
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Type | Central focusing |
| Eyepieces for eyeglass wearers | yes |
Details
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Splash-proof | yes |
| Waterproof | yes |
| Protective bag | yes |
| Tripod thread | yes |
| Lens hood | yes |
| Eyepiece cap | yes |
| Inert gas charge | yes |
| Belt attachment | yes |
Field of view
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| True field of view (°) | 6,66 |
| Field of view at 1,000 m (m) | 117 |
| Shortest focusing distance (m) | 2 |
Luminosity & Twilight Factor
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Brightness | 25 |
| Twilight factor | 22,4 |
General
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Surface material | Rubber upholstery |
| Color | Green |
| Length (mm) | 140 |
| Width (mm) | 172 |
| Height (mm) | 61 |
| Weight (g) | 905 |
